Sql Для Тестировщика: Зачем Qa Нужно Знать Sql Блог Mate Academy

Реляционные базы данных, или базы данных на основе SQL, изобретены в 1970 году в компании IBM, и это все еще основной тип БД. Они используют язык SQL для управления данными и выполнения запросов. Данные в реляционной базе данных организованы в соответствии со схемой — «чертежом», который описывает, как будут храниться данные.

Он использует синтаксис, который разработан для понимания людьми, одновременно предоставляя мощные инструменты для работы с данными. SQL-оператор UNION используется для объединения результатов двух или более SELECT-запросов в один набор данных. Другими словами, оператор UNION позволяет объединить данные из нескольких SELECT-запросов в один результат. Это полезно, когда мы хотим объединить sql для тестировщиков данные из двух или более таблиц или представлений в один набор данных.

sql для тестировщиков

Он подходит как начинающим специалистам, так и действующим IT-профессионалам, желающим углубить свои знания. Авторский состав курса включает опытных практиков из IT-индустрии, гарантируя актуальность и прикладной характер обучения. Учитывая то, что оптимизатор Postgres склонен недоoценивать (underestimate) кардинальности джойнов, данная методика выглядит вполне обоснованной. Теперь, используя критерий прочитанных страниц попробуем посмотреть, какой эффект даёт расширение AQO оптимизатора PostgreSQL на запросах теста JOB.

sql для тестировщиков

Практические Задачи И Примеры Решений

  • Знание SQL также позволяет тестировщикам понять, как потенциальные злоумышленники могут попытаться использовать SQL для получения несанкционированного доступа к данным.
  • Традиционной поддержка реляционной БД поддерживается с помощью SQL.
  • Данные действия в большинстве случаев вообще не требую знаний СКЛ.
  • Врядли нужно говорить, что эта часть исследования зачастую является ключевой разработчика, поскольку обосновывает смысл того, что мы вообще тратим своё время на чтение всего предшествующего текста.

После установки вы сможете использовать SQL Server Management Studio (SSMS) для управления базами данных. Также есть узкоспециализированные тренинги, которые предлагают обучение в более сжатые сроки — от three до 4 месяцев. Главная задача — это обеспечить бесперебойное и безопасное развертывание приложений в производственной среде, что позволяет ускорить вывод нового функционала и повысить стабильность работы системы. В отличие от разработчиков, которые занимаются кодом и исправлением багов, DevOps-инженеры не фокусируются на внутреннем функционале приложения. Вместо этого они работают с инструментами автоматизации, системами управления конфигурациями и инфраструктурой для быстрого и эффективного развертывания приложений в продакшен. Ориентирован на тех, кто хочет понять ключевые методики и инструменты, используемые в DevOps-процессах.

sql для тестировщиков

В конкретно моей области оптимизации запросов – execution-time выглядит избыточным параметром. И для сравнения различных подходов к оптимизации или для оценки эффекта нового преобразования в одном и том же оптимизаторе PostgreSQL стоит использовать более конкретную характеристику. Теперь, когда у нас есть общее представление о базе данных, давайте перейдем к базовым командам SQL. Чтобы определить SQL-запрос, нам сначала нужно понять, что такое запрос? Запрос может быть определен как запрос данных из базы данных через СУБД.

Итак, знание SQL является важным для тестировщиков программного обеспечения. Оно позволяет им получать, анализировать и манипулировать данными напрямую из баз данных, что помогает обеспечить целостность данных и эффективность системы. С помощью SQL QA-инженеры могут проводить тестирование производительности, выявлять проблемы безопасности, включая SQL-инъекции, и способствовать общей стабильности и надежности программного обеспечения. SQL-инъекции могут серьезно повлиять на безопасность программного обеспечения. В случае успешной атаки злоумышленник может получить доступ к чувствительной информации, такой как пароли пользователей, личные данные, информацию о платежах и т.

SQL-запрос — это запрос данных из БД с помощью СУБД https://deveducation.com/ (система управления базами данных). Запрос представляет собой инструкцию на основании определенных критериев. Тестировщик с помощью SQL-запроса может оценить корректность работы системы. Для работы с реляционными базами данных используют язык SQL, поэтому часто реляционные БД так и называют — базы данных SQL. Почти ежедневно мы проверяем почту, выбираем фильмы и сериалы на стриминговых платформах, покупаем онлайн, переводим деньги или пользуемся поисковиком. Всё это работает благодаря системам управления базами данных и языку запросов SQL.

Рекомендую всем кто хочет набраться опыта в понимании структуры SQL-запросов. Оператор FULL OUTER JOIN используется для объединения всех записей из обеих таблиц, когда между ними есть общие записи. Таким образом, оператор FULL OUTER JOIN позволяет объединить данные из двух таблиц, включая все записи из обеих таблиц, а также только те записи, которые имеют совпадающие значения в общем столбце.

Программа охватывает такие ключевые темы, как автоматизация процессов, управление конфигурациями и внедрение CI/CD. Участники смогут освоить популярные инструменты — Docker, Kubernetes и Jenkins, и научатся применять их в реальных проектах. Обучение проходит под руководством опытных наставников, которые готовы помочь в решении сложных задач. Я говорю что в СКЛ вообще лезть не обязательно, на подготовленных данных согласно формуле расчёта легко получить ожидаемый результат, вообще без СКЛ. Тут квалификация вообще не причём, человек либо понимает как устроены данные в приложении либо нет. Хотелось бы от вас услышать совет о том, какие практические задачи, с точки зрения эмуляции требований работодателя, было бы здорово дома порешать в качестве практики.

Выпускники могут рассчитывать на среднюю зарплату в 180,000 рублей в месяц и получают помощь с трудоустройством или возврат денег. Программа включает сбор требований, управление базами данных SQL, проектирование систем с BPMN и UML, а также управление проектами по методологиям Agile Стадии разработки программного обеспечения и Scrum. Бизнес-аналитики, руководители и менеджеры применяют SQL для поддержки бизнес-процессов и оптимизации операций.

Возможности Языка Sql

Используется для объединения всех записей из обеих таблиц, если между ними есть общие записи. Для объединения записей из левой таблицы и общих записей обеих таблиц. IN используется для указания нескольких значений в WHERE-части запроса. Команда RENAME DATABASE — для переименования существующей базы данных. В таблице ниже, если условие выполняется, то возвращается булево значение «True». Те специалисты, которые им владеют, имеют преимущество перед коллегами.

Команды Linux Быстрый Гайд Для Новичков

Тестировщики часто сталкиваются с необходимостью проверять данные в базах данных, писать запросы для выборки данных и анализировать результаты. Понимание SQL является важным навыком для тестировщиков, особенно при работе с базами данных. SQL позволяет выполнять различные операции с данными, такие как выборка, вставка, обновление и удаление данных. Это делает его незаменимым инструментом для тестировщиков, работающих с базами данных. SQL (Structured Query Language) расшифровывается как “язык структурированных запросов”. Это язык программирования, который используется для запроса информации из базы данных.

Lascia un commento

Il tuo indirizzo email non sarà pubblicato. I campi obbligatori sono contrassegnati *